Suspect Arrested in Essaouira Wedding Procession Crash After Taunting Authorities

The elements of the National Security of Marrakech in coordination with the Royal Gendarmerie succeeded in arresting in Safi the son of the owner of a private clinic who had rammed a car on the wedding procession in Essaouira at the beginning of February before fleeing.
The arrest of the accused follows his appearance in several videos. In these videos, he taunted the authorities who had not been able to arrest him until then. Enough to provoke the anger of the security services of the province. The elements of the Brigade for the Fight against Criminal Gangs of the Judicial Police of Marrakech in coordination with the Royal Gendarmerie mobilized and were able to arrest him on June 2 in the company of two individuals.
The preliminary investigation reveals that these two individuals had been hiding the main accused since the crime committed in early February. The public prosecutor’s office decided to prosecute them for "non-denunciation".
